Le Boréal offers itineraries that are impressive. She joined Compagnie du Ponant as a premium vessel in 2010, showing magnificent lines, elegance and furnishings that reflect modern French marine architecture. She is 5-star, “your own private yacht.” With 264 guests and 140 crew service is personal.

Technically, her dynamic positioning system (no anchors) and ‘Clean Ship’ standards are impressive. Fellow passengers come from many backgrounds, are well-travelled and refined. You’ll find all amenities are modern, ample space for sun-bathing or solitude, theatre for 250 with entertainment on selected evenings, and fine dining.

Onboard Experience

  • Dining

    French cuisine making good use of local fresh foods is a feature of this vessel. The two restaurants welcome guests to breakfast, lunch and dinner. The 268-seat Gastronomic Restaurant, at the rear and adjacent to the Marina, serves meals and complimentary wines worthy of the finest restaurants. The smaller Grill Restaurant adjacent to the pool offers al fresco dining with buffet lunches and themed dinners. Read more

    Dress for dining is smart casual – it’s only the waiters who wear black ties and white gloves.

  • Bars

    The forward-looking Panoramic Lounge and Terrace, and the Main Lounge off Reception are comfortably fitted with leather seats and are just the places to build friendships, perhaps with a drink or cocktail. There is also an open-air bar on the top Sun Deck. Each afternoon pastries and drinks are served.

  • Entertainment

    Lounges are used for lectures by prominent experts, depending on the voyage, and also for shows, as is the 260-seat Theatre.

  • Activities

    For solitude retire to the library, games area with Wii™ consoles, or Internet room. Every guest can feel comfortable relaxing in their own way. Guests will find that most entertainment comes from ocean views and on-shore excursions. After all, this is an expedition vessel!

  • Health & Fitness

    The Fitness centre is fitted with the latest equipment such as Kinesis Wall, exercise cycles and running machines. The Beauty Centre offers treatments by Sothys, and includes a range of massages and pampering.

  • Kids

    All ships have a special area for children onboard known as the Le Kids Club. Books, television, board games and consoles (PS4 or Wii™) are all provided to keep younger guests entertained.

Cabins

All 132 staterooms are of generous size with sea views, and include all the usual luxury amenities: DVD, CD and iPod players with Video on Demand, Internet access, controllable air-conditioning, bath robe and toiletries, wardrobes encased in white leather, and king or twin beds. On Deck 3 there are eight Superior Staterooms each with a panoramic window, and 28 Deluxe Staterooms with balcony, walk-in robe and bathtub. On Decks 4 to 6 there are 92 Prestige Staterooms. Forty of these can be linked with adjoining cabins and reconfigured, to make 20 Prestige Suites.

These will have two bathrooms, and separate sleeping and entertainment areas. Staterooms can accommodate a third person. On Deck 6 is the one very large Owner’s Suite with its own dining area, and three large Deluxe Suites. Full Butler Service is available to the 13 suites on Deck 6, to attend to your every need. Three cabins are specially adapted for disabled guests, and adjacent to elevators. Three elevators service all decks. There is 24 h room service with a dining menu. From May 2015 the minibar will be complimentary.)
